Story Dice
Roll dice with pictures. Build a story together using vocabulary from the lesson.
âą 20-25 min⥠Low energyðĨ Groups of 3-5

ð Materials
âĒ Story dice (Rory's Story Cubes or homemade)
âĒ Paper and pens
ð How to Play
- Each group has a set of 6-9 picture dice.
- One child rolls all the dice.
- The group must create a short story using ALL the pictures shown on the dice.
- The story must use vocabulary from the current lesson.
- Groups write their story â minimum 6 sentences.
- Each group reads their story to the class.
- Class votes on the most creative story.
ðĄ Teacher Tips
âYou can make simple dice using blank wooden cubes and stickers with pictures.
âTeach story connectors first â "First... Then... Next... After that... Finally..."
âSet a minimum sentence count to prevent one-line stories.
âThis activity develops creativity and is excellent for writing practice.
ð Variations
âEach child adds one sentence â collaborative chain story.
âRoll one die only â build a story where that image appears in every sentence.
âUse vocabulary flashcards instead of dice â pick 6 cards and build a story.
